    Ive Had this lamp for over 20 yrs? It was my grand fathers that use to be on the downstairs bar he had. Ive tried researching it but always seem to run into dead ends.Would Just like a little info about it?

      Your "lantern" is from about 1962, and was used as a point of purchase sign around the introduction of the king size bottled drink package to stores. As a good rule of thumb, the "fishtail" logo as collectors call it, (correct name is the "arciform" logo) was used from about 1959 to 1969. By 1969 and 1970 the company was transitioning into the current "dynamic ribbon" logo. Its value is around 200-300 dollars, primarily because it is a light up.
